  • Publication number: 20190368192
    Abstract: A splinter binding and weight bearing foil with an adhesive and a glass pane in a smoke barrier system. The smoke barrier system includes a fixation element. The adhesive is arranged between the splinter binding foil and the glass pane, wherein the splinter binding foil is equipped to hold glass fragments of a glass pane together in case of a glass breakage. The splinter binding foil is arranged between the fixation element and the glass pane, in particular the splinter binding foil is clamped between the fixation element and the glass pane. The splinter binding foil is designed to detach from the glass pane in the case of fire and/or temperature influence.

  • Publication number: 20190192100
    Abstract: A method is disclosed for registration on setting an alignment of an instrument relative to an object during a processing or treatment of the object by the instrument. A working image is registered to a planning image. The working image is recorded in a viewing direction that is selected dependent upon relevant degrees of freedom of the instrument such that the relevant degrees of freedom are the degrees of freedom with the greater registration accuracy. In addition, a robot system is provided which is configured for carrying out the method.

  • Publication number: 20190192105
    Abstract: A method for calibrating a medical imaging device in terms of an image acquisition geometry, a method for performing a two-dimensional-three-dimensional registration based on corresponding calibration data, and a corresponding system are provided. Multiple images of a phantom are acquired using the imaging device in different positions of the phantom. A corresponding motion of the phantom from one position to a respective next position is tracked by a tracking device to keep continuous track of a spatial relation between the phantom and the imaging device. The medical imaging device is then calibrated based on the acquired images, corresponding recorded poses of the imaging device, and the tracked motion of the phantom.

  • Publication number: 20190157923
    Abstract: An electric motor can include a stator body defining fluid channels extending axially for fluid communication between axial ends of the stator body. Conductive windings can form first loops extending axially outward from the first end of the stator body and second loops extending axially outward from the second end of the stator body. A first cap can be coupled to the first end of the stator body and can include a first wall. The first wall can be between the first loops and the channels. Pins can extend from a side of the first wall that is opposite the first loops. The second cap can be coupled to the second end of the stator body and include a second wall. The second wall can be between the second loops and the channels. Pins can extend from a side of the second wall that is opposite the second loops.

  • Publication number: 20190099223
    Abstract: A method is provided for controlling a robotic device, of which the end effector arranged on a kinematic chain interacts with an object, and including an ultrasound apparatus registered to the robotic device for movement capture of the object. Ultrasound image data of the object is captured. The relative movement of the object is determined on the basis of the ultrasound image data using a mathematical method. The absolute movement is determined through registration to a planning data set. Movements of the object are compensated for in the context of the interaction of the end effector of the robotic device with the object. Future movements of the object and a positioning of the end effector of the robotic device adapted thereto are predicted and the robotic device is controlled accordingly. In the calculation of the adapted positioning of the end effector of the robotic device, a temporal delay relative to the movement of the object is included.
